Job Description

Description:
Job Summary:
This role plays a key role in supporting the operational efficiency and cost-effectiveness of the organization. This position is responsible for procuring goods and services in alignment with production needs, quality standards, and budget goals. The Purchasing Specialist works closely with internal stakeholders and external suppliers to ensure timely and accurate delivery of materials, while maintaining compliance with purchasing policies and procedures. Understand market conditions relative to the products and services required by Feldmeier Equipment for the manufacturing process. Secure the most competitive pricing available in the current market, meet the quality requirements provided, and ensure on-time delivery to meet production requirements.
Requirements:
Essential Minimum Duties and Responsibilities:
Comply with all Feldmeier policies including, but not limited to safety, procedure, and regulatory standards. Process purchase orders in accordance with company policies and ERP system (e.g.,Epicor) Monitor supplier performance and address delivery delays, shortages, or quality issues. Select and develop supply sources for assigned material and service category to ensure most competitive pricing and on-time delivery. Collaborate with production, inventory, planning, and quality teams to ensure material availability aligns with manufacturing schedules. Create and update material master information such as pricing and lead time. Improve efficiency and productivity with BOM verification and correction, make-offload decision, transfer order, and material substitution. Work with finance team to ensure PO and invoice accuracy. Manage inventory levels of assigned material category. Work with production service team and finance team to reduce inventory carrying costs.
Minimum Qualifications:
Four-year business degree or 5 years in procurement and supply chain management Experience with EPICOR and steel industry - preferred Familiarity with purchasing steel or metal materials, including understanding of specifications, grades, lead times, and market pricing trends - preferred
Physical Requirements:
Ability to stand and/or walk for up to 8 hours per day. The ability to work on a computer for up to 8 hours a day. Ability to work in a high volume and high stress environment. Ability to lift up to 20 pounds occasionally. Ability to communicate professionally, in written and oral communications.
